Article 1. Scope of Regulation

This Decree provides detailed provisions for certain Articles of the Environmental Protection Law, including Article 91 on reducing greenhouse gas emissions, Article 92 on protecting the ozone layer, and Article 139 on organizing and developing the carbon market.

Article 2. Applicability

This Decree applies to organizations and individuals involved in activities related to greenhouse gas emissions, reducing emissions and absorbing greenhouse gases; participating in the development of the domestic carbon market; producing, importing, exporting, consuming, and disposing of ozone-depleting substances and controlled greenhouse gases under the Montreal Protocol on Substances that Deplete the Ozone Layer.

Article 3. Explanation of Terms

1. The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) is an agency of the United Nations responsible for providing information and scientific basis regarding human-induced climate change, its impacts on nature, politics, and economy, and measures to address climate change.

2. Ozone-depleting substances and controlled greenhouse gases under the Montreal Protocol on Substances that Deplete the Ozone Layer (referred to as controlled substances) are substances and compounds listed in Appendices A, B, C, E, and F of the Montreal Protocol.

3. Industrial processes are industrial activities causing greenhouse gas emissions from non-energy chemical and physical processes; they are among the sectors required to conduct greenhouse gas inventories according to the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change.

4. The United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change (UNFCCC) is an international environmental agreement aimed at minimizing human impact on the global climate system, including stabilizing greenhouse gas concentrations in the atmosphere.

5. Carbon credit trading mechanisms are mechanisms implementing registration and implementation of programs and projects to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and generate carbon credits according to internationally or domestically recognized methods. Carbon credits from these programs and projects can be traded on the carbon market or offset excess greenhouse gas emissions beyond allocated quotas.

6. Nationally Determined Contributions (NDCs) are commitments made by countries regarding climate action, including adaptation and mitigation targets, policies, and measures to address climate change to achieve the goals of the Paris Agreement.

7. Measurement, Reporting, and Verification (MRV) system for reducing greenhouse gas emissions is a system collecting, processing, managing, storing, providing, and verifying information on the implementation of greenhouse gas emission reduction measures to ensure transparency, accuracy, and verifiability.

a) Measurement is the activity of determining the amount of greenhouse gases reduced by mitigation measures according to methods recognized by competent authorities;

b) Reporting is the activity of calculating, compiling, and submitting results of measuring greenhouse gas emission reductions and related information according to guidelines, procedures, and forms issued by competent authorities;

c) Verification is the activity of evaluating reports on measurement results of greenhouse gas emission reductions and related information according to methods and procedures issued by competent authorities.

8. Business-as-usual scenario (BAU) is a scientifically-based assumption about the level of greenhouse gas emissions under normal economic and social development conditions in the future without implementing greenhouse gas emission reduction measures.

9. Greenhouse gas inventory is the activity of collecting information and data on sources of greenhouse gas emissions, calculating greenhouse gas emissions and absorption within a defined scope and specific year according to methods and procedures issued by competent authorities.

10. The Montreal Protocol on Substances that Deplete the Ozone Layer is an international agreement on protecting the ozone layer through phasing out the production and consumption of ozone-depleting substances and greenhouse gases with negative impacts on human health and the environment.

11. Rated cooling capacity is the cooling capacity of refrigeration or air conditioning equipment at standard conditions and marked on the manufacturer's label.

12. Carbon credit exchange is a center handling transactions of buying, selling carbon credits, emission quotas, auctions, loans, payments, transfers of emission quotas.

13. Recycling controlled substances is the process of using technological and technical solutions to recover components from controlled substances for reuse according to their original characteristics.

14. Reusing controlled substances is the act of using controlled substances again after cleaning without changing their properties.

15. Ton of CO₂ equivalent is the quantity of various greenhouse gases converted into tons of CO₂ based on their Global Warming Potential (GWP). The GWP of greenhouse gases is determined by the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change.

16. The Paris Agreement is an international agreement under the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change, effective from 2021, stipulating the responsibilities of member states regarding adaptation and mitigation of greenhouse gas emissions through Nationally Determined Contributions.

17. Collecting controlled substances is the activity of removing controlled substances from a system and storing them in an external container.

18. Trading emission quotas and carbon credits is the activity of buying, selling, auctioning, lending, paying, transferring emission quotas and carbon credits on the carbon credit exchange.

19. Disposing of controlled substances is the process of destroying controlled substances using technological and technical solutions to avoid negative impacts on human health and the environment.

Article 4. Principles for Reducing Greenhouse Gas Emissions and Protecting the Ozone Layer

1. Reducing greenhouse gas emissions and protecting the ozone layer must be consistent with economic and social conditions, current laws, relevant regulations, and international treaties with the aim of developing a low-carbon economy and green growth linked to sustainable development.

2. Management of activities to reduce greenhouse gas emissions must follow the principles of responsibility, unity, fairness, and transparency; the target for reducing greenhouse gas emissions shall be adjusted by the Prime Minister according to national development priorities and international treaties to which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a party.

3. Activities involving the exchange of greenhouse gas emission quotas and carbon credits must ensure transparency and balance the interests of subjects on the carbon market. Organizations and individuals participating in the carbon market do so voluntarily.

4. The import and export of substances that deplete the ozone layer and greenhouse gases can only be carried out with countries that are members of the Montreal Protocol, following the timelines set forth in the Protocol.

Article 6. Establishment and Update of Sectors and Facilities Required to Conduct Greenhouse Gas Inventories

1. Facilities emitting greenhouse gases that must conduct greenhouse gas inventories are those with annual greenhouse gas emissions of 3,000 tons of CO₂ equivalent or more, or fall into one of the following categories:

a) Thermal power plants and industrial production facilities with total annual energy consumption of 1,000 tons of oil equivalent (TOE) or more;

b) Freight transportation companies with total annual fuel consumption of 1,000 TOE or more;

c) Commercial buildings with total annual energy consumption of 1,000 TOE or more;

d) Solid waste treatment facilities with annual operating capacity of 65,000 tons or more.

2. The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ment, in collaboration with ministries specified in paragraph 2 of Article 5 of this Decree and provincial People's Committees, shall review, compile, and establish the list of sectors and facilities required to conduct greenhouse gas inventories, submitting it to the Prime Minister for issuance; every two years, they shall submit to the Prime Minister for decision on updating the list of sectors and facilities required to conduct greenhouse gas inventories.

3. Provincial People's Committees shall direct relevant specialized agencies to periodically, every two years, perform the following tasks:

a) Based on the criteria stipulated in paragraph 1 of this Article, review energy consumption data, capacity, and scale of facilities listed in the sectors and facilities emitting greenhouse gases required to conduct greenhouse gas inventories from the previous year;

b) Update and adjust the list of facilities emitting greenhouse gases required to conduct greenhouse gas inventories within their jurisdiction according to the criteria stipulated in paragraph 1 of this Article, sending it to the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ment and relevant sectoral management ministries before June 30 starting from 2023.

Article 16. Participants in the Domestic Carbon Market

1. Entities falling under the category specified in Clause 1, Article 5 of this Decree.

2. Organizations participating in domestic and international carbon credit trading mechanisms in compliance with laws and international treaties to which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a party.

3. Other organizations and individuals involved in activities related to investment and trading in greenhouse gas emission quotas and carbon credits on the carbon market.

Article 17. Development Roadmap and Implementation Timeline for the Domestic Carbon Market

1. Until the end of 2027

a) Establish regulations governing carbon credit management, greenhouse gas emission quota trading, and carbon credit activities; develop operational rules for the carbon credit trading platform;

b) Implement pilot programs for carbon credit trading and offset mechanisms in potential sectors and provide guidance on implementing domestic and international carbon credit trading and offset mechanisms in compliance with laws and international treaties to which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a party;

c) Establish and operate a pilot carbon credit trading platform from 2025;

d) Enhance capacity and raise awareness about developing the carbon market.

2. From 2028

a) Officially operate the carbon credit trading platform in 2028;

b) Specify activities connecting and facilitating domestic carbon credit trading with regional and global markets.

Article 18. Confirmation of carbon credits and greenhouse gas emission quotas traded on the domestic carbon market exchange transactions on the intra-country carbon market trading platform

1. The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ment shall confirm carbon credits and greenhouse gas emission quotas traded on the exchange, including:

a) The amount of carbon credits obtained from programs and projects under the domestic and international carbon credit trading and offset mechanisms in accordance with the provisions of the law and international treaties to which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a party;

b) Greenhouse gas emission quotas allocated as provided for in Clause 2, Article 12 of this Decree.

2. Procedures and formalities for confirmation

a) Organizations and individuals wishing to have their carbon credits and greenhouse gas emission quotas traded confirmed pursuant to Clause 1 of this Article shall submit an application form No. 01 attached as Appendix V of this Decree to the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ment through the online public service system to obtain confirmation;

b) Within fifteen working days, the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ment shall organize verification, issue a confirmation certificate, and notify the organization or individual; if a confirmation certificate is not issued, the reasons must be clearly stated.

3. The confirmation certificate for carbon credits and greenhouse gas emission quotas traded shall be in Form No. 02 attached as Appendix V of this Decree.

Article 19. Trading of greenhouse gas emission quotas and carbon credits on the domestic carbon market

1. The trading of greenhouse gas emission quotas and carbon credits shall be conducted on the carbon credit exchange and domestic carbon market in accordance with the regulations.

2. Greenhouse gas emission quotas and carbon credits for trading

a) Greenhouse gas emission quotas specified in Clause 2, Article 12 shall be traded on the exchange. One unit of greenhouse gas emission quota equals one ton of CO₂ equivalent;

b) Carbon credits obtained from programs and projects under the carbon credit trading and offset mechanism may be converted into offset units for greenhouse gas emission quotas on the exchange. One carbon credit equals one ton of CO2 equivalent.

3. Auctioning, transfer, borrowing, repayment of greenhouse gas emission quotas, and using carbon credits to offset greenhouse gas emissions

a) Facilities may auction to acquire additional greenhouse gas emission quotas beyond the allocated quota for the same commitment period;

b) Facilities may transfer unused greenhouse gas emission quotas from the previous year to subsequent years within the same commitment period;

c) Facilities may borrow greenhouse gas emission quotas allocated for the following year to use in the preceding year within the same commitment period;

d) Facilities may use carbon credits from projects under carbon credit trading and offset mechanisms to offset excess greenhouse gas emissions over the allocated quota for the same commitment period. The quantity of carbon credits used for offsetting shall not exceed ten percent of the total allocated greenhouse gas emission quotas for the facility;

d) Allocated greenhouse gas emission quotas will automatically be recovered by the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ment when facilities cease operations, dissolve, or go bankrupt;

e) The State encourages facilities to voluntarily repay unused greenhouse gas emission quotas to contribute to the national goal of reducing greenhouse gas emissions;

g) At the end of each commitment period, facilities must pay for the excess greenhouse gas emissions over the allocated quota after applying auctioning, transfer, borrowing, and using carbon credits for offsetting. In addition to paying for the excess emissions, the amount exceeding the allocated quota will be deducted from the allocation for the next commitment period;

h) The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ment shall guide the auctioning, transfer, borrowing, and repayment of greenhouse gas emission quotas.

Article 20. Registration of Programs and Projects under the Mechanism of Carbon Credit Exchange and Offset

1. Subjects establishing and implementing programs and projects under the mechanism of carbon credit exchange and offset

a) Vietnamese organizations with the need to establish and implement programs and projects;

b) Foreign organizations with the need to establish and implement programs and projects on the territory of Vietnam.

2. The subjects specified in Clause 1 of this Article shall submit registration applications for approval of programs and projects under the mechanism of carbon credit exchange and offset within the framework of the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change, treaties, and international agreements to which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a party, to the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ment through one of the following methods: direct submission, online submission, or postal service. The application for project approval includes:

a) An application form for program and project approval according to Model No. 03 attached as Appendix V to this Decree;

b) Program and project documentation prepared in accordance with guidelines issued by the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ment, consistent with the provisions of the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change, treaties, and international agreements to which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a party;

c) A technical report or an independent assessment report of the program and project in accordance with guidelines issued by the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ment, consistent with the provisions of the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change, treaties, and international agreements to which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a party;

d) A copy from the original record or a certified copy of various permits and related documents concerning the specialized activities of the program and project in accordance with current regulations.

3. Evaluation and Approval of Programs and Projects under the Mechanism of Carbon Credit Exchange and Offset within the Framework of the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change, Treaties, and International Agreements to Which the Socialist Republic of Vietnam is a Party.

a) Within five working days from the date of receipt of the application, the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ment will notify the organization of one of the following situations: acceptance of a valid application; request for supplementation or completion of the application or rejection if the application is invalid. The deadline for supplementing or completing the application is not more than fifteen working days from the date of the written notification requesting supplementation or completion of the application;

b) Within thirty working days from the date of receipt of a valid application, the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ment will organize the evaluation of the application for program and project approval through soliciting opinions from relevant agencies. The agency solicited must provide a written response within a maximum of seven working days from the date of receipt of the solicitation letter accompanying the application;

c) Within three working days from the date of the evaluation result, the Minister of Natural Resources and Environment will consider and decide on the approval of the program and project and notify the applying organization; in case of non-approval, the reasons must be clearly stated.

Article 22. Substances that Deplete the Ozone Layer and the Phasedown Schedule for Such Substances

1. Substances that deplete the ozone layer include:

a) Bromochloromethane;

b) Carbon tetrachloride (hereinafter referred to as CTC);

c) Chlorofluorocarbons (hereinafter referred to as CFC);

d) Halons;

e) Hydrobromofluorocarbons (hereinafter referred to as HBFC);

f) Hydrochlorofluorocarbons (hereinafter referred to as HCFC);

g) Methyl bromide;

h) Methyl chloroform.

2. The phasedown schedule for HCFC substances is as follows:

a) From January 1, 2022 to December 31, 2024: total national consumption shall not exceed 65% of the base consumption level;

b) From January 1, 2025 to December 31, 2029: total national consumption shall not exceed 32.5% of the base consumption level;

c) From January 1, 2030 to December 31, 2039: average annual national consumption shall not exceed 2.5% of the base consumption level;

d) From January 1, 2040: importation and exportation of HCFC substances shall be prohibited.

3. Total national consumption of HCFC substances shall be determined based on the quantity of HCFC substances imported minus the quantity exported. The base consumption level of HCFC substances converted according to their ozone-depleting potential is 221.2 tons.

4. Methyl bromide may only be imported for quarantine and disinfection purposes for exported goods.

5. Prohibited acts under Clause 11, Article 6 of the Environmental Protection Law include:

a) Producing, importing, temporarily importing, re-exporting, and consuming Bromochloromethane, CTC, CFC, Halon, HBFC, Methyl chloroform, and HCFC 141b;

b) Producing, importing, temporarily importing, re-exporting, and consuming products or equipment containing or produced from Bromochloromethane, CTC, CFC, Halon, HBFC, Methyl chloroform, and HCFC 141b;

c) Producing, importing, and consuming products or equipment containing or produced from banned controlled substances;

d) Producing, importing, and consuming banned controlled substances as prescribed by the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ment.

Article 23. Greenhouse Gas-Inducing Substances to be Controlled and the Phased Management and Elimination of Such Substances

1. Greenhouse gas-inducing substances to be controlled are Hydrofluorocarbons (hereinafter referred to as HFCs).

2. The phased management and elimination of HFCs shall proceed as follows:

a) From January 1, 2024 to December 31, 2028: the national consumption volume shall not exceed the baseline consumption level; the national production volume shall not exceed the baseline production level;

b) From January 1, 2029 to December 31, 2034: the national consumption volume shall not exceed 90% of the baseline consumption level; the national production volume shall not exceed 90% of the baseline production level;

c) From January 1, 2035 to December 31, 2039: the national consumption volume shall not exceed 70% of the baseline consumption level; the national production volume shall not exceed 70% of the baseline production level;

d) From January 1, 2040 to December 31, 2044: the national consumption volume shall not exceed 50% of the baseline consumption level; the national production volume shall not exceed 50% of the baseline production level;

đ) From January 1, 2045: the national consumption volume shall not exceed 20% of the baseline consumption level; the national production volume shall not exceed 20% of the baseline production level.

3. National Consumption Volume of HFCs

a) The national production volume of HFCs is determined based on the amount of HFCs produced minus the amount of HFCs destroyed, converted to equivalent CO₂ volume;

b) The national import volume of HFCs is determined based on the amount of HFCs imported minus the amount of HFCs exported, converted to equivalent CO₂ volume;

c) The national consumption volume of HFCs is determined based on the sum of the national production volume of HFCs and the national import volume of HFCs as specified in points a and b of this clause.

4. Baseline Consumption and Production Levels of HFCs

a) The baseline consumption level of HFCs is determined based on the average consumption level of HFCs converted to equivalent CO₂ volume for the years 2020, 2021, and 2022 plus 65% of the baseline consumption level of HCFCs as stipulated in Clause 3, Article 22 of this Decree, converted to equivalent CO₂ volume;

b) The baseline production level of HFCs is determined based on the average production level of HFCs converted to equivalent CO₂ volume for the years 2020, 2021, and 2022.

5. The Minister of Natural Resources and Environment shall announce the baseline production and consumption levels of HFCs in Vietnam before December 31, 2023; periodically announce the national consumption volume according to the phases specified in Clause 2 of this Article.

Article 24. Registration and Reporting of Usage of Controlled Substances

1. Entities required to register production, export, import; production, import, ownership of equipment, products containing or produced from controlled substances; collection, recycling, reuse, and disposal of controlled substances (hereinafter collectively referred to as organizations using controlled substances) include:

a) Organizations engaged in the production of controlled substances;

b) Organizations engaged in the export, import of controlled substances;

c) Organizations producing, importing equipment, products containing or produced from controlled substances;

đ) Organizations providing services for the collection, recycling, reuse, and disposal of controlled substances.

d) Organizations owning equipment containing controlled substances: air conditioning units with a rated cooling capacity greater than 26.5 kW (90,000 BTU/h) and a total rated cooling capacity of all such equipment exceeding 586 kW (2,000,000 BTU/h); industrial refrigeration equipment with power exceeding 40 kW.

2. Entities as defined in Clause 1 of this Article shall submit one set of application forms for the use of controlled substances (hereinafter referred to as the application form) to the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ment before December 31, 2022, through one of the following methods: direct submission, online submission, or postal service. In cases where the application form is submitted via postal service, the receipt date will be based on the postmark.

3. The application form includes:

a) An application form for the use of controlled substances according to Model No. 01 of Appendix VI issued together with this Decree: one original copy;

b) A document proving the legal status of the registering organization in accordance with the law: one certified copy stamped with the seal of the registering organization.

4. Within three working days from the date of receiving the application form, the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ment shall notify the registering organization about the acceptance of a valid application form or request for additional or completed information. The deadline for supplementing or completing the application form is no more than five working days from the date of notification requesting such action.

5. Within ten working days from the date of receiving a valid application form, the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ment shall compile, evaluate the application form, and publish information about organizations that have completed the registration process for the use of controlled substances on the electronic information website of the state management agency for climate change.

6. Entities as defined in Clause 1 of this Article shall be responsible for submitting reports on the usage of controlled substances to the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ment annually by January 15 through direct submission, online submission, or postal service according to Model No. 02 of Appendix VI issued together with this Decree. In cases where the report is submitted via postal service, the receipt date will be based on the postmark.

7. Entities established and operating after December 31, 2022, as defined in Clause 1 of this Article shall be responsible for completing the registration procedures and reporting on the usage of controlled substances as stipulated in this Article.

Article 25. Requirements for Allocation, Adjustment, and Supplement of Production and Import Quotas for Controlled Substances

1. The production and import quotas applicable to controlled substances as specified in point e, Clause 1, Article 22 and Clause 1, Article 23 of this Decree shall be applied.

2. The quotas allocated annually to organizations shall not exceed the national consumption volume of controlled substances.

3. The allocation of production and import quotas for controlled substances to organizations each year shall be determined based on quota management requirements, usage needs, and the average usage volume of the organization over the last three years. The total allocated quota volume shall not exceed 80% of the quota volume prescribed in Clause 2 of this Article.

4. The allocation of remaining quota volumes shall be carried out in the following priority order:

a) Organizations using controlled substances with low global warming potential that have additional quota needs. The value of low global warming potential is determined based on Vietnam's National Plan for Management and Elimination of Controlled Substances;

b) Organizations registering after December 31, 2022;

c) Organizations already allocated quotas that have additional quota needs.

5. Organizations allocated quotas may only use the allocated quotas within the year they are allocated.

6. The allocation of production and import quotas for controlled substances to organizations registering after December 31, 2022 shall be determined based on an assessment of the application for quota usage needs, company capability documentation, and balancing against the remaining national quota.

7. Organizations using greenhouse gas substances with low global warming potential shall be considered for supplementary production and import quotas based on ranking according to their equivalent CO2 consumption volume ratio over the last three years.

8. Adjustments and supplements to quotas shall be carried out based on the request of organizations allocated quotas, the usage situation of allocated quotas by organizations, and balancing against the remaining national quota.

9. Organizations importing controlled substances under allocated quotas but subsequently exporting them shall be considered for supplementary import quotas not exceeding the exported quantity.

Article 28. Collection, Recycling, Reuse, and Disposal of Controlled Substances

1. Organizations producing, importing equipment or products containing or produced from controlled substances; owning equipment containing controlled substances as specified in points c and d of Clause 1, Article 24 of this Decree shall carry out collection, recycling, reuse, and disposal of controlled substances according to the following principles:

a) Mandatory collection of controlled substances when they are no longer used in equipment or products starting from January 1, 2024;

b) Encouragement of recycling and reuse of collected controlled substances;

c) In cases where recycling and reuse of controlled substances are not carried out, the organization must dispose of them for destruction in accordance with the laws on hazardous waste management;

d) Annual reporting on the use of controlled substances in accordance with Clause 6, Article 24 of this Decree.

2. Collection, transportation, and storage of controlled substances shall be carried out as follows:

a) Controlled substances generated during installation, repair, and maintenance of individual products or equipment shall be collected, transported, and stored in accordance with this Decree;

b) For cases where collected controlled substances can be recycled or reused, recycling and reuse shall be carried out in accordance with regulations of the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ment;

c) For cases where recycling or reuse is not possible, transportation, storage, and disposal shall be carried out in accordance with laws on hazardous waste management.

3. Collection, transportation, and storage of controlled substances must meet the following requirements:

a) Having minimum equipment for collecting controlled substances including recovery machines, recovery tanks, vacuum pumps, weighing scales, leakage detection devices, pressure gauges, and safety tools;

b) Having technicians meeting the requirements set forth in Clause 4 of this Article;

c) Having safe collection, transportation, and storage procedures in accordance with regulations of the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ment.

4. Technicians installing, operating, maintaining, and repairing equipment containing controlled substances must have appropriate certificates or diplomas; or be certified upon completion of training courses on collection and disposal of controlled substances organized by the Ministry of Labor, Invalids, and Social Affairs in coordination with the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ment.

5. Individuals owning equipment or products containing or produced from controlled substances who no longer use them shall be responsible for transporting them to designated collection points without altering the shape of the equipment or products or transferring them to entities authorized to collect, transport, and dispose of such substances in accordance with regulations.

6. The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ment shall develop and issue national technical standards on collection, transportation, storage, recycling, reuse, and disposal of controlled substances before October 31, 2023.
